是否有任何非root用户选项可以帮助我处理不需要的系统应用程序?
#1 楼
不,那是不可能的-因为只有root才能使系统分区可写(删除存储在其中的系统应用程序是必需的)。但是,使用ICS(Android 4.0)或更高版本,您至少可以“冻结”它们(使其变为“不可见且不可用”),并且,如果以后再决定,还可以再次对其进行冻结(请参见例如,如何删除/禁用HTC One X或Bye-bye中的Bloatware应用程序,膨胀软件:禁用Android Ice Cream Sandwich中的系统应用程序。#2 楼
我在大多数情况下都同意Izzy的回答,但是从技术上讲,也可以不这样做。背景: br /> / system是一个单独的分区,在正常使用时只读安装。
有些电话(HTC)甚至将闪存分区锁定为不允许进行任何写操作。 / system可写并在那里删除具有root权限的东西
Rooting是在普通Android系统上成为root并通过安装一些文件(/ usr / xbin / su等)使其持久化的过程。 />要删除不生根的应用程序,就不必不扎根手机,而是找到另一种方法来从/ system删除不需要的应用程序。在Google Nexus设备上,一个人可以解锁并启动临时自定义恢复即可做到这一点(普通Android实例无需生根)
对于三星设备,人们可以使用与CF-Root一样的方法(下载分区,修改,写回)
或t在没有生根过程的情况下运行漏洞利用程序,并使用该临时根进行所有必需的清除操作。我只是想解释一下,从技术上讲这确实是可能的
评论
您能否详细介绍一下针对Samsung(Galaxy Y)的操作,还是可以提供链接?
–user16112
2012年7月30日15:54
我没有链接,对不起。我想说,最简单的方法是root / remove-junk / unroot请参阅此处。如果您真的想在不生根的情况下执行此操作:您可以查看unroot.zip的内容,并创建自己的update.zip来删除不喜欢的内容。但是:您需要学习如何做以及脚本的工作方式,但是要注意风险:您很容易摔坏手机。更好的root + unroot之后,这是一条已知路径。
–ce4
2012年7月30日在20:16
只是在这里大声思考;但是您不能将手机连接到Linux计算机并从那里挂载/ system分区吗?
– RobinJ
2012年8月21日在10:14
不可以。没有root用户,无法通过USB大容量存储访问/ system的块dev。同样,常规的Linux不支持yaffs2。
–ce4
2012年8月21日在10:46